Output 7edebf1a78dd6daee1061ffbed584ae9fe4cd2d41c2059a428844c0171b05e49:8

value
4420308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7cc3d68b5cbfed63703b617d0676e497559475a OP_EQUAL
address
3JSrFV3RY7Lk1abT8yhjHZMqRtu2yYA6eu
transaction
7edebf1a78dd6daee1061ffbed584ae9fe4cd2d41c2059a428844c0171b05e49
confirmations
287486
spent
true